Output faab5caa32f83e19584a97c5eb5d64c9bbf01df67ad8ccc9a80ee95c35652b88:0

value
656506
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0fd5e22b23c1c25eab4ff75e3cdac41cddcba910 OP_EQUALVERIFY OP_CHECKSIG
address
12SjMmAoKABmZWBxGGc6imzR6wjQy91r1B
transaction
faab5caa32f83e19584a97c5eb5d64c9bbf01df67ad8ccc9a80ee95c35652b88
confirmations
470593
spent
true